Pelee Passage

Pelee Passage lies in the western end of Lake Erie, and is the name given to the channel running through the gap created by Point Pelee and Pelee Island. Lake depths run in the 30 to 40 foot range, with the Pelee Passage Light marking the western edge of various shoals, including Grubb Reef, and Middle Ground Shoal; and the Southeast Shoal Light marking the eastern edge, about 6 miles away.
